Output 21ba88c0d01de25d6126a58b8307882fd40073c4a8e743822ab7d30f6621b6b3:40

value
8530500
script pubkey
OP_0 OP_PUSHBYTES_20 1c84e64470e076cc1d061411cbebc0a143a5bd44
address
ltc1qrjzwv3rsupmvc8gxzsguh67q59p6t02ysgtldt
transaction
21ba88c0d01de25d6126a58b8307882fd40073c4a8e743822ab7d30f6621b6b3
spent
true